diff --git a/mirva/__init__.py b/mirva/__init__.py
index 1b2a501..3dff957 100644
--- a/mirva/__init__.py
+++ b/mirva/__init__.py
@@ -1,4 +1,4 @@
-__version__ = "20210920.1"
+__version__ = "20211114.0"
def get_version():
diff --git a/mirva/mirva.py b/mirva/mirva.py
index dd5fb88..f9a102e 100755
--- a/mirva/mirva.py
+++ b/mirva/mirva.py
@@ -158,43 +158,7 @@ Released : 20110306
{page_title}
-
+
@@ -303,6 +267,7 @@ function create_button(direction, to) {{
"arrow_down.png",
"banner.jpg",
"mirva.ico",
+ "mirva.js",
):
if os.path.exists(os.path.join(self.resource_dir, f)):
continue
diff --git a/mirva/resources/mirva.js b/mirva/resources/mirva.js
new file mode 100644
index 0000000..7c418a5
--- /dev/null
+++ b/mirva/resources/mirva.js
@@ -0,0 +1,61 @@
+let current=0;
+function r(f){/in/.test(document.readyState)?setTimeout('r('+f+')',9):f()}
+r(function(){
+ create_nav();
+ document.onkeydown = keyboard_entry;
+
+});
+function create_nav() {
+ let navis = document.getElementsByClassName("navigation");
+ for (let i = 0; i